| #include "guacamole/error.h" |
| #include <errno.h> |
| |
| #ifdef ENABLE_WINSOCK |
| # include <winsock2.h> |
| #else |
| # ifdef HAVE_POLL |
| # include <poll.h> |
| # else |
| # include <sys/select.h> |
| # endif |
| #endif |
| |
| #ifdef HAVE_POLL |
| int guac_wait_for_fd(int fd, int usec_timeout) { |
| |
| /* Initialize with single underlying file descriptor */ |
| struct pollfd fds[1] = {{ |
| .fd = fd, |
| .events = POLLIN, |
| .revents = 0 |
| }}; |
| |
| int retval; |
| |
| /* No timeout if usec_timeout is negative */ |
| if (usec_timeout < 0) { |
| GUAC_RETRY_EINTR(retval, poll(fds, 1, -1)); |
| return retval; |
| } |
| |
| /* Handle timeout if specified, rounding up to poll()'s granularity */ |
| GUAC_RETRY_EINTR(retval, poll(fds, 1, (usec_timeout + 999) / 1000)); |
| return retval; |
| |
| } |
| #else |
| int guac_wait_for_fd(int fd, int usec_timeout) { |
| |
| /* Prevent overflowing fd_set. */ |
| if (fd >= FD_SETSIZE) { |
| errno = EINVAL; |
| return -1; |
| } |
| |
| int retval; |
| fd_set fds; |
| |
| /* Initialize fd_set with single underlying file descriptor */ |
| FD_ZERO(&fds); |
| FD_SET(fd, &fds); |
| |
| /* No timeout if usec_timeout is negative */ |
| if (usec_timeout < 0) { |
| GUAC_RETRY_EINTR(retval, select(fd + 1, &fds, NULL, NULL, NULL)); |
| return retval; |
| } |
| |
| /* Handle timeout if specified */ |
| struct timeval timeout = { |
| .tv_sec = usec_timeout / 1000000, |
| .tv_usec = usec_timeout % 1000000 |
| }; |
| |
| /* Linux (kernel/glibc verified): select() does not modify |
| fd_set on -1, and updates struct timeval to reflect elapsed |
| time on EINTR, so neither needs reinitialization on retry. */ |
| GUAC_RETRY_EINTR(retval, select(fd + 1, &fds, NULL, NULL, &timeout)); |
| return retval; |
| |
| } |
| #endif |
